Our Upper School Robotics Teams competed at their final regular season meet last weekend in Ramsey, NJ and by all accounts D-Emonstrated a great finish! Our Varsity team, Critical Mass (Team 207), held a record of 4-1. Our JV team, Absolute Zero (Team 13048), finished with a record of 3-2. These results were good enough for both teams to be selected to compete in the elimination rounds!
Head Coach Chris Fleischl shared, “In the elimination rounds, Absolute Zero competed as a member of the 6th seeded alliance. Despite a valiant effort, they were knocked out by the 1st seeded alliance. Critical Mass played in the 3rd seeded alliance with their parter, Hypnotic Robotics from River Dell High School. Together, they won their first 3 matches and advanced to the finals. In the finals, they defeated the 1st seeded alliance, avenging their sister team, and winning the tournament!”
Congratulations to Teams Critical Mass and Absolute Zero for their hard work during the season and especially during this competition. Both teams now prepare for the Bergen County League Tournament on Feb. 23! GO BULLDOG ‘BOTS!!!
